also, why cant i increase the native resolution without experiencing lag?
probably the speed of your processor has something to do with it
Wrong,most probably your graphics card can't take the extra load. If GSdx is reporting above 90% usage,your gfx card is bottlenecking your system (which is like 99% sure if the lag appears on a higher native resolution)
